I have just received a Cisco SF 200E-24P switch and need to upgrade the firmware. The current version is 1.0.0.12 an need to load the latest (or at least 1.1) to get CDP etc. However when I use the upgrade option in the switch I get an error of..

Firmware Image download through HTTP failed. Wrong File Type

I have tried 3 different versions of the firmware and get the same error message each time.

Can anyone help?

Simon, my apoligies. I am a complete idiot!

I just read the email notification and saw SF 200 E. This is why! It uses a .stk file.

SF200e-24x_FW_1.0.5.1.stk
